Abstract :
In order to manage the technical condition of its physical assets and according to its established asset management policy, EDP Distribuição frequently inspects its High Voltage (HV) and Medium Voltage (MV) overhead power lines. Such inspections are carried out by a specialized service provider, using a manned helicopter or personnel on the ground. Helicopter inspections require a crew of at least an experienced pilot and two technicians are expensive and have security concerns (risk of mechanical failure or collision). Unmanned Aerial Vehicles (UAV) bring potential benefits, since they partially mix the advantages of having a fast, potentially economic and autonomous scanning of a predefined set of waypoints with the flexibility of having closer looks at specific points on the grid and with a significantly lower operational risk. Furthermore, current inspections methods, like thermographic analysis and Light Detection And Ranging (LiDAR), are giving growing amounts of information which have to be properly managed using adequate algorithms. In this context, EDP Distribuição promoted the development of an algorithm to support the decision making process, regarding interventions on detected anomalies and subsequent works based on several relevant criteria, and is performing field tests with some commercial UAV solutions.
